Chula Vista Olympic Training Center 20th Anniversary

The Chula Vista U.S. Olympic Training Center (CVOTC) will ring in its 20th anniversary next month with a community celebration featuring lots of fun, heart-pumping Olympic activities and a VIP breakfast.

The 20th anniversary party will be held on June 7 from 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. at the center located at 2800 Olympic Pkwy. The event is free and open to the public.

There, guests will have a chance to try their hand at Olympic and Paralympic sports including BMX, archery, field hockey, rugby, beach volleyball, soccer and wheelchair tennis. Guests can also experience running with a blindfold and guide runner like some of the CVOTC’s visually-impaired athletes.

Athlete attendees include:
 
Steve Holcomb - Bobsled (3-time Olympic Medalist, 4-time World Champion)
 
Brittney Reese - Track & Field (2012 Olympic Gold Medalist, 5-time World Champion - long jump)
 
Susan Francia - Rowing (2-time Olympic Gold Medalist, 5-time World Champion)
 
David Wagner - Wheelchair Tennis (3-time Paralympic Gold Medalist with six medals total)
 
Felicia Stancil - BMX (2016 Olympic hopeful, 2013 UCI Junior World Champion)
 
Lex Gillette - Paralympic Track & Field (3-time Paralympic Silver Medalist, World Champion and World Record holder - visually impaired long jump)
 
Nathan Yamaguchi - Archery (2016 Olympic hopeful, 2014 World Field Championships team member)
